Product details

The collected Vajra songs of the great Tibetan yogi Milarepa (1052-1135) are considered classics of Buddhist literature. They are the spontaneous expression of Milarepa's immediate insight into the true nature of things and testify to his deep compassion for all beings. These songs were written down in the 15th century by the "crazy" yogi Tsang Nyön Heruka. Even today, Milarepa's unusual life story and his teachings presented in song form serve as a great source of inspiration for many people.

In this second volume of the famous Vajra songs, further stories about Milarepa's wandering life are gathered, detailing his experiences in the solitude of the mountains and his encounters with people, goddesses, and demons. Readers will gain a fascinating insight into Tibetan culture and way of life at the beginning of the second millennium. Are there still masters like Milarepa in our time? The 16th Karmapa, bearer of Milarepa's transmission line, once said: "Lama Gendün Rinpoche has attained the level of Vajradhara in one lifetime, just like Milarepa." The translator of this book, Henrik Havlat, practiced for many years under the guidance of Gendün Rinpoche and worked on this translation, inspired by his blessing.
